The 3D viewer is often pre-installed on Windows computers, so you shouldn't need to download it separately. To find the 3D Viewer on your PC, you can follow these simple steps:
1. In the Windows search bar, type '3D Viewer' and press Enter. This will search your PC for the 3D Viewer app and show you the results.
2. If the 3D Viewer app is installed on your PC, it should appear in the search results. You can then click on it to open the application and start using it to view your 3D content.
3. If you don't see the 3D Viewer in the search results, it's possible that the app is not installed on your PC. In that case, you can visit the Microsoft Store and search for '3D Viewer' to download and install the app.
Once you've located the 3D Viewer on your PC, you can use it to open and view 3D models, explore interactive presentations, and even make simple edits to your 3D content. The 3D Viewer is a versatile tool that supports a variety of file formats, including 3MF, FBX, OBJ, PLY, STL, and GLB.
